This basement had cracking and bowing walls, putting the home's foundation at risk. To reinforce the structure, we installed CarbonArmor straps—strong, fiber-reinforced polymers that bond to the wall and prevent further movement. This non-invasive solution provides long-term stability, ensuring the home remains safe and secure.
When a homeowner discovered cracks in the block walls of his basement, he promptly reached out to Mid-State Basement Systems for assistance. Recognizing that even small cracks can indicate underlying damage, he sought a solution to protect his home. Our dedicated inspector, Jiovanni, conducted a thorough assessment and concluded that the CrabonArmour Wall Reinforcing System was the ideal approach for this project.
The CrabonArmour System incorporates flexible carbon fiber fabric straps, renowned for their exceptional tensile strength, which surpasses that of steel by up to 10 times. Our skilled crew swiftly initiated the necessary repairs. Using a high-strength epoxy resin, the carbon fiber straps were securely bonded to the interior surface of the wall. This innovative technique provides the stability required to reinforce and strengthen the wall, preventing further damage.
By opting for the CarbonArmor Wall Reinforcing System, the homeowner took proactive steps to safeguard his basement and protect his home's structural integrity.
Our crew installed 9 PowerBraces in this Canal Winchester, OH Basement. When the homeowners bought the house, it already had some posts in place but they were failing. Our PowerBrace consists of steel I-beams that are secured to the joists above the wall with steel brackets. This system is easily adjustable, allowing for tightening of the brace to attempt to raise the wall back to its original position. This system doesn't involve any exterior excavation and installs quickly with minimal disruption to your basement space.
This Pickerington, OH homeowner got creative when they noticed their floor was sinking a bit. They propped up the floor joists with a large pole, but knew the solution wasn't permanent. The Mid-State Basement Systems team installed a steel i-beam to support the floor above.
This Pickerington, OH homeowner called Mid-State Basement Systems when they noticed their first floor was sinking in one spot. Our crew, led by Foreman Manuel Inguil, installed a SmartJack to help support the floor joist and prevent the floor from falling into the basement.
